The Requirements Completeness Evaluation Checklist will help project managers minimize trouble down the road by evaluating whether the initial requirements are complete enough to move forward. Give your project requirements a complete quality check. This download has been translated into Japanese.

Requirements attributes help you determine whether each checkpoint applies to your project.

Quality checks ask whether the requirements, as you've drawn them up, are written as thoroughly as hey need to be.

Each quality check is also supported by real world examples.
